Each indicator nowcast from its strongest leading series — inferable from observations already in hand.

Leading-indicator nowcastDerived

For each indicator, India's strongest leading series is fit by ordinary least squares over their shared observed history, then the leader's already-observed recent values project the target — so the next year or two is inferable from data already in hand. These are nowcasts from a leading correlation: correlation, not causation, and not a guaranteed forecast.

Reliability badges show each indicator's best model skill— how much it beats a naive last-value forecast, measured out-of-sample on that series' own observed history (backtested one-step-ahead). A track record, not a guarantee of future accuracy.
